“Refining titles” generally refers to the process of improving, polishing, or updating titles for clarity, impact, or search engine optimization (SEO). 1. Content Marketing & SEO (Articles, Blogs, Videos)

Refining titles here means making them more clickable and search-friendly. Be Specific: Use precise keywords.

Focus on Impact: Craft titles that grab attention, increase clicks, and boost conversions.

Use Subheadings: Narrow the focus to make the topic clearer.

Add Context: Limit to specific years, age groups, or languages to make the topic more relevant. 2. Technical/Programming Context (Refine.dev)

In the context of the Refine framework (a React-based framework for building CRUD apps), refining titles refers to changing the default “Refine Project” title and icon in the browser tab.

Customization: You can update the title and logo using refine.new or by editing the project’s configuration files. 3. General Meaning (Dictionary Definition)

To refine means to make something free from impurities, or to make it more polished and elegant. Regarding language, it means making text more subtle, polished, or precise.
